English: “The earth became corrupt” — a Tanna of the school of R’ Yishmael taught: Wherever the term “corruption” (hashchatah) is used, it refers only to matters of sexual immorality and idolatry.
On the daf / in context: The midrash halachah equates the verb “hishehit” with the two cardinal sins of the generation of the Flood: illicit relations and idolatry. The parallel verse “ki hishhit kol basar et darko” supplies the sexual dimension; Deuteronomy 4:16 supplies the idolatry dimension.
Type of Learning
Custom (definition of a technical term from parallel occurrences; school of R’ Yishmael).
What Is Learned
“Corruption” of the earth denotes sexual immorality and idolatry — the sins that sealed the decree against the generation of the Flood.
